Lines Matching refs:angle1
282 int angle1, angle2; in miFillArcSliceSetup() local
284 angle1 = arc->angle1; in miFillArcSliceSetup()
286 angle2 = angle1; in miFillArcSliceSetup()
287 angle1 += arc->angle2; in miFillArcSliceSetup()
290 angle2 = angle1 + arc->angle2; in miFillArcSliceSetup()
291 while (angle1 < 0) in miFillArcSliceSetup()
292 angle1 += FULLCIRCLE; in miFillArcSliceSetup()
293 while (angle1 >= FULLCIRCLE) in miFillArcSliceSetup()
294 angle1 -= FULLCIRCLE; in miFillArcSliceSetup()
306 slice->edge1_top = (angle1 < HALFCIRCLE); in miFillArcSliceSetup()
308 if ((angle2 == 0) || (angle1 == HALFCIRCLE)) { in miFillArcSliceSetup()
315 else if ((angle1 == 0) || (angle2 == HALFCIRCLE)) { in miFillArcSliceSetup()
317 if (angle1 ? slice->edge1_top : slice->edge2_top) in miFillArcSliceSetup()
323 if (angle2 < angle1) { in miFillArcSliceSetup()
336 miGetPieEdge(arc, angle1, &slice->edge1, in miFillArcSliceSetup()
348 if ((angle1 == 0) || (angle1 == HALFCIRCLE)) { in miFillArcSliceSetup()
349 x1 = angle1 ? -w2 : w2; in miFillArcSliceSetup()
352 else if ((angle1 == QUADRANT) || (angle1 == QUADRANT3)) { in miFillArcSliceSetup()
354 y1 = (angle1 == QUADRANT) ? h2 : -h2; in miFillArcSliceSetup()
358 x1 = Dcos(angle1) * w2; in miFillArcSliceSetup()
359 y1 = Dsin(angle1) * h2; in miFillArcSliceSetup()